2016 Head Coach: Tom Goebel

Tommy Goebel grew up in Parma, and played for the Parma Flyers organization before joining the Cleveland Barons.  As a Cleveland Baron in 1998, Tom and his team won the tier 1 National Championship, the only team from Ohio to ever accomplish this.  Following his youth hockey time with the Barons, Tom played junior hockey at age 15, and in his final season he was awarded MVP of the NAHL.  Tom went on to play 4 years of Division 1 College Hockey and graduated from The Ohio State University in 2008 when he was a team Captain and received team MVP.  Upon graduation, Tom began his six year professional career in both North America and Europe. Immediately following his playing career, Tom jumped into coaching with U18 Cleveland Barons. In his first year as a head coach, he led the U14 Barons to the organization's first Tier 1 League Championship. After three years as coach, Tom took on the role of Hockey Director for the Barons program. During his time as director, he founded the Cleveland Athletic Academy which features an online schooling option for Cleveland area players. CAA  is now redesigning skill development, camps and clinics in the Cleveland Area. When Tom isn't on the ice, he co-owns and operates two physical therapy practices, Strength Fitness & Therapy in the area.  This past season Tom is currently the head coach for Cleveland Barons 2013 Elite and is actively involved in the Mite program for Strongsville Youth Hockey. He is looking forward to coaching the 2016 Elite this upcoming year.  Tom resides in Independence, Ohio with his wife Mallory and three sons.
